Growing demands on AI skills

As we move into 2024, the influence of artificial intelligence (AI) on the job market continues to expand, shaping new paradigms and creating a growing demand for specialized professionals. Companies are increasingly seeking individuals with in-depth technology skills, especially in the area of ​​AI, to remain competitive and innovative. The evolution of work, driven by social networks and new technologies, has put AI knowledge at the center of attention when it comes to recruitment and career development.

Onlinecurriculo, a leading online CV platform, carried out an in-depth study of the vacancies available on the market, analyzing more than 260 opportunities on platforms such as LinkedIn, Indeed and Glassdoor. The objective was to identify the skills most valued by companies in AI professionals.

Professional profiles on the rise

Among the most sought after skills, the following stand out:

  • Software Developers: Sought after for their ability to create innovative AI solutions and evaluate the impact of applied AI models.
  • data scientists: Experts in data analysis, predictive modeling and applying AI to optimize processes.
  • Business Analysts: Responsible for identifying business opportunities and carrying out analyzes with the support of AI.
  • Programmers: Focused on coding, systems maintenance and program development using AI.
  • AI experts: Tasked with designing and implementing AI solutions to solve specific problems and optimize processes.
  • Data Analysts: Tasked with collecting, organizing and interpreting data, using AI to optimize the workflow.
  • AI or Machine Learning consultants: Focused on the integration of technological areas and the development of product evolution strategies.
  • New Business Executives: Specialized in developing customer service strategies and applying AI solutions.
  • Artificial Intelligence Engineers: Responsible for developing, programming and training complex algorithms that function as a “brain” within companies.

In addition to highlighting the functions and skills sought, the study also revealed details about the vacancy levels (junior, full and senior), salaries (ranging from R$1.500 to R$30.000), locations of opportunities, types of hiring (CLT and PJ) and the availability of internships and research grants in the field of AI.

Preparing for the future of work

Companies are already using AI in their selection processes, which means candidates need to be prepared to interact with AI-based recruitment systems. Preparation goes further, involving the optimization of resumes and cover letters with the help of AI tools to increase the chances of success.

For those looking to join or relocate to companies that value AI knowledge, it is crucial to understand which skills are most in demand and seek courses that offer these skills. The entry of generation Z into the job market has also contributed to the formation of a new employee profile, more integrated and aware of the use of technology. Staying up to date and receptive to technological innovations is essential, regardless of age, to bring innovative ideas and effective solutions to the professional environment.
